![]() Revelation 5:10 says that God made us priests and kings who are called to reign upon this earth. Psalm 110:2 refers to King Jesus and says that He is to "rule in the midst of your enemies." The Lord will not return until His enemies have been made His footstool. The Church is the body of Christ (Eph 5:23). He is the head and we've been called to be the ones who will make a footstool for our Lord (Ps. 110:1, Mk. 12:36). The question is, where does Christ's rule and reign start? Genesis 4 provides us insight in the context of the first murder ever committed. Genesis 4:7 - If you do what is right, will you not be accepted? But if you do not do what is right, sin is crouching at your door; it desires to have you, but you must master it." NIV The dominion of Christ begins with the rule and mastery over our own will, emotions, feelings and actions resulting from those emotional thoughts. Emotions, anger, desires, cravings, etc. in and of themselves are not sin. Ephesians 4:26 teaches us that it is possible to have the emotion of anger and yet, not sin. So it is with our other emotions, thoughts and feelings. Having the emotion or thought is not sin, but our actions could lead to a wrong decision that hurts us and others. Jesus said in Matthew 4:17 to repent for the kingdom of heaven is at hand. The question is, what is in your hand? Your mind, will and emotions are. Therefore, are you struggling with an emotion, anger, desire, craving, lust, bitterness, envy, etc. then turn to God's word and prayer.
